DocuSign Keeps Department of Transportation in the Fast Lane

The state Department of Transportation (DOT), responsible for thousands of miles of roadway and complex projects, struggled with insecure, paper-based signing—engineers had to physically sign multi-page plans, there was no document management or automated workflow, and the department needed a legally acceptable, on-premises solution that integrated with Active Directory and SharePoint. They sought a scalable, standards-based electronic signature system that external partners could use through the department’s intranet and extranet.

The DOT chose the DocuSign Signature Appliance, integrating it with SharePoint and Active Directory to centralize certificate management and enable multi-page, legally verifiable signing. The rollout began with 200 internal engineers, expanded to external consultants via the SharePoint portal, and is scaling toward 3,000 licenses; the appliance is now used in grant management, HR forms and other workflows, significantly reducing paper handling and speeding signature processes.
